EE6611 LAB Questions

The document outlines 11 experiments to be conducted for a Power Electronics and Drives Lab course. Each experiment involves identifying the aim, drawing the circuit diagram, performing calculations, executing the connection, recording results, and participating in a viva. Students will be evaluated out of 100 marks for each experiment based on their performance in the different evaluation criteria.
